Andhra Pradesh launched Digi Rythu Bazaar pilot in Visakhapatnam’s MVP Colony Rythu Bazaar. It digitizes farm-to-home delivery of fresh produce at bazaar prices, bypassing middlemen via website orders within 5-km radius, with cash-on-delivery. Plans include a mobile app and digital payments; expansion across the state if successful, empowering farmers and offering affordable alternatives to apps like Swiggy.
